Output 39e17434966c343fbdec9e2d8fe91a5d59e79da4a24b5d40281b2163972b1918:9

value
987360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c77d46d91f0db10bae412ef5c7f37a9de9c88e0 OP_EQUAL
address
3QhwkofBrVc3MKuh1C6NzDh1Tw5ZhbWB9C
transaction
39e17434966c343fbdec9e2d8fe91a5d59e79da4a24b5d40281b2163972b1918
spent
true